SCOPE OF REVIEW: The scope of this plan review covers architectural, plumbing, mechanical, energy conservation and electrical. All code references are to the 2003 International Residential Code, 2003 International Energy Conservation Code, and Arizona State amendments to the 2003 Uniform Plumbing Code. All features were checked only to the extent allowed by the submittals provided. All portions of this project are assumed to meet or will meet other departmental requirements, conditions and concerns before permit approval. I. GENERAL REQUIREMENTS: 1. All corrections and revisions shall be made on original tracings or finished reproducible set. Return two copies of the corrected set along with a set of the first submission. Pen or pencil corrections on final prints will not be acceptable. To avoid delays, ensure that all corrections have been made, are complete, and have been coordinated on all applicable detail and note sheets. 2. As of June 13, 2007 the City of Tucson has adopted the 2006 IRC with the exception of the plumbing portion which has been replaced with the Uniform Plumbing Code with amendments. The plans should reference these codes. 3. Provide entire plan with consecutive sheet numbers on each construction drawing, R106.1.1. II. SECTIONS - DETAILS: 1. Eave ventilation is not appropriate without attic space, or rafter cavity space between insulation and roof sheathing. Remove venting from frieze boards or show a minimum 1" ventilation clearance between ceiling insulation and roof sheathing, R806.3.
